Pilgrims of Divine Mercy
In this road movie four repeat offenders, who converted in prison, set off on foot to the Vatican, drawing a special trolley with a gift for the pope – a painting of Merciful Jesus. What they have in common, apart from their criminal past, is faith and hope that their effort will help them to forget about the demons of the past. Heavy physical exertion will put their notions of community and faith to the test. They will meet many interesting people on the way, but what is the most important will happen between them.

He earned his BA in Philosophy of Nature from the Cardinal Wyszyński University in Warsaw. He embarked on his film career at the amateur film group Fraction/35. Seeking his own form of expression, he is fascinated by historiosophy and documentary film production. His debut "The Crow" (2014) has won several awards in Poland and abroad. He started work on his feature-length debut "Pilgrims of Divine Mercy" (2020) in 2015 and the entire period brought important changes in the artist’s life.
